Although pharmacologists make this sort of mistake, doctor additionally suggest the wrong dose of a prescription medicine. Dosage mistakes can be caused by negligence, reviewing the incorrect patient chart, and writing down the wrong terms for dosage. Advising the wrong size spoon for dental administration is another usual source of drug dose mistakes.

The very first demand is establishing that an official doctor-patient partnership existed. This relationship produces a lawful responsibility for the healthcare provider to provide care that fulfills professional criteria. The partnership normally starts when a person seeks clinical focus and the doctor accepts offer therapy. It is a form of specialist carelessness that can be tried in a law court. Confirming medical negligence needs demonstrating that a company made a significant error, caused actual harm, and went against the requirement of treatment Maryland legislation requires.
